Transaction 8db6051fad07e33897fa5dc754bd56a222e5aeb92e7ed9d915febd33ddf2e61c
1 Input
1 Output
-
8db6051fad07e33897fa5dc754bd56a222e5aeb92e7ed9d915febd33ddf2e61c:0
- value
- 528378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45623db9d4b35407ae1d70ddde3c8a9ba540cb41 OP_EQUAL
- address
- 381tEh7sZcdNe6DFJF9wsRs3VJia12CPsX